Write On Art Competition

Asima 10A participated in the Write on Art Competition in the UK and was selected as a winner in the Creative Writing category. This prestigious competition is organised by the Paul Mellon Centre for Studies in British Art (PMC) in collaboration with Art UK. Write on Art was created to encourage interest in art, art history, and writing among young people aged 14–19, and to promote critical engagement with artworks in local collections.

As part of this achievement, Asima attended a creative writing workshop at the Royal College of Art (RCA), London, in September, where she collaborated with other young writers and received mentoring from Jeremy Millar, artist and Head of Programme for the Writing MA at the Royal College of Art.
